PCB avoids making betting company Pak-NZ series sponsors

The main title sponsor of Pakistan vs New Zealand series is a bank, and no questionable website is included in the sponsor’s list as of now.

Some dubious sponsors have been involved with Pakistan cricket over the past few years. Despite appearing to be news websites, several of them were found to be affiliated with betting businesses and operating under false names.

Some of these businesses were seen as sponsors in the eighth PSL after first supporting the bilateral series. A few cricketers also voiced their opposition to this practice. Wicket-keeper batter Mohammad Rizwan had covered the Multan Sultans’ sponsor’s logo during the PSL 8 playoffs.

Authorities have reportedly warned the marketing department and the corporation holding legal rights to steer clear of surrogate sponsorship firms because they believe they present a false picture.

The sponsors of the New Zealand series do not include “DafaNews.” The organization known as “Dafabet” supports cricket in various nations using the same logo as “DafaNews.”

A bank is the headline sponsor of the next series against the Kiwis; up until this point, no substitute “news website” has been included among the sponsors. At this time, it’s unclear whether the board decided to maintain this practice moving forward or if it was only for this particular series.
